Pakistan mosque blast: 7 killed, 25 injured

A deadly explosion occurred near a mosque in Pakistan on Friday, claiming the lives of at least seven individuals. The incident took place in Mastung, Balochistan, as local residents were assembling at the mosque to celebrate the birthday of Prophet Muhammed (Peace be upon him).

Over 25 people sustained injuries, and authorities are in the process of transporting them to medical facilities.

A government official described the explosion as “massive” and noted that a procession was scheduled to take place later.
